Asamamah forms neighbourhood watch committee

Akim Asamamah(E/R), May 25, GNA – In an efforts to combat the rising cases of armed robbery and other criminal activities in the area, the people of Akim Asamamah and other communities in the Atiwa District have formed neighbourhood watch committees.

Briefing the Ghana News Agency at Akim Asamamah at the weekend, the leader of the Committee, Mr Kofi Kyei said, of late farmers had been complaining of thefts of foodstuffs and threats of death on their farms by unknown people.

The situation, he said, had created panic among the citizens thereby inspiring the communities to be more alert and intensify their efforts to combat the crimes..

Some of the communities, which have also formed the committee are Akim Asunafo, Akim Akorso, Akim Abrenya and Akim Abrasuso. Mr Kyei stated that the committees operated both day and night and noted that since the formation of the groups, life had returned to normal with farmers going to their farms without fear.

A farmer at Akim Abrenya, Madam Ellen Awo, who confirmed the story said women farmers were now able to go to their farms without fear of the robbers, saying it would spur them on to continue with their farming activities.
